The next evening the committee assembled earlier, so as to get a view of the planet Venus before the moon rose. It was the first time that the lad's attention had been drawn to any of the planets, and he evinced the liveliest joy when he first beheld the cloudless disk of that resplendent world. It may here be stated that his power of vision, in looking at the fixed stars, was no greater or less than that of an ordinary eye. They appeared only as points of light, too far removed into the infinite beyond to afford any information concerning their properties. But the committee were doomed to a greater disappointment when they inquired of the boy what he beheld on the surface of Venus. He replied, "Nothing clearly; all is confused and watery; I see nothing with distinctness." The solution of the difficulty was easily apprehended, and at once surmised. The focus of the eye was fixed by nature at 240,000 miles, and the least distance of Venus from the earth being 24,293,000 miles, it was, of course, impossible to observe that planet's surface with distinctness. Still she appeared greatly enlarged, covering about one hundredth part of the heavens, and blazing with unimaginable splendor.

Experiments upon Jupiter and Mars were equally futile, and the committee half sorrowfully turned again to the inspection of the moon.

It was on the evening of the 17th of February, 1876, that we ventured with rather a misgiving heart to approach Culp Hill, and the humble residence of a child destined, before the year is out, to become the most celebrated of living beings. We armed ourselves with a pound of sugar candy for the boy, some muslin-de-laine as a present to the mother, and a box of cigars for the father. We also took with us a very large-sized opera-glass, furnished for the purpose by M. Muller. At first we encountered a positive refusal; then, on exhibiting the cigars, a qualified negative; and finally, when the muslin and candy were drawn on the enemy, we were somewhat coldly invited in and proffered a seat. The boy was pale and restless, and his eyes without bandage or glasses. We soon ingratiated ourself into the good opinion of the whole party, and henceforth encountered no difficulty in pursuing our investigations. The moon being nearly full, we first of all verified the tests by the committee. These were all perfectly satisfactory and reliable. Requesting, then, to stay until after midnight, for the purpose of inspecting Mars with the opera-glass, we spent the interval in obtaining the history of the child, which we have given above.

The planet Mars being at this time almost in dead opposition to the sun, and with the earth in conjunction, is of course as near to the earth as he ever approaches, the distance being thirty-five millions of miles. He rises toward midnight, and is in the constellation Virgo, where he may be seen to the greatest possible advantage, being in perigee. Mars is most like the earth of all the planetary bodies. He revolves on his axis in a little over twenty-four hours, and his surface is pleasantly variegated with land and water, pretty much like our own world—the land, however, being in slight excess. He is, therefore, the most interesting of all the heavenly bodies to the inhabitants of the earth.

Having all things in readiness, we directed the glass to the planet. Alas, for all our calculations, the power was insufficient to clear away the obscurity resulting from imperfect vision and short focus.

Swallowing the bitter disappointment, we hastily made arrangements for another interview, with a telescope, and bade the family good night.
